• Our Broadening Thesis Continues to Play Out...The Equal Weighted S&P

500 has continued to outperform the Cap Weighted S&P, while Consumer

Discretionary Goods and Transports have each outperformed the S&P 500

by 12% over the past two months. We continue to see support from

accelerating earnings growth across the median stock, expanding Artificial

Intelligence adoption, lower expected oil prices, and a Federal Reserve that

remains on hold.
